There is a significant gap in the cost of living between these two cities. State College is 17.2% cheaper than West Chester. With a cost index of 104 vs 126, the difference would have a meaningful impact on a household's monthly budget. Someone relocating from State College to West Chester should plan for substantially higher expenses across most categories.

On the housing front, median rent in State College is $1,229/month compared to $1,661/month in West Chester — a 26% difference. Home values follow the same pattern: State College is more affordable at $414,400 median vs $481,300.

Median household income in State College is $47,132 compared to $81,492 in West Chester (-42.2%). While West Chester is more expensive, its higher salaries more than compensate — residents there may actually end up with more disposable income. Looking at affordability, residents of State College spend roughly 31.3% of their income on rent, more than the 24.5% in West Chester. The West Chester ratio exceeds the commonly recommended 30% threshold, which can put pressure on household budgets.

Climate-wise, West Chester is notably warmer with an average of 52.3°F compared to 48.7°F in State College. West Chester receives more rainfall at 47.1" per year compared to 40.3" in State College.
